Vermont Citizens Advisory Committee on Lake Champlain Meeting

The Vermont Citizens Advisory Committee (VTCAC) meeting will be held Monday, April 10th, 5:00 – 7:00 pm at the Shelburne Town Offices, Meeting Room 1.  

Learn more about the proposed federal budget cuts and the implications for Lake Champlain.
